have someone there

English dictionary entry

Meanings

verb
  1. To put someone in a disadvantageous position, as in an argument, such that someone doesn't have an appropriate answer or solution.

Word forms

have someone there has someone there having someone there had someone there
This entry uses open data from Wiktionary (CC BY-SA/GFDL). Word forms are used for search and are not indexed as separate pages.